Design

Freestanding electric fireplaces don't require venting or chimneys they are more versatile than wood-burning models. They can be moved from room-to-room according to your requirements and are much more affordable than wood-burning fireplaces with mantels. They aren't able to heat the entire home as effectively as central furnaces, therefore they might not be a good option for large spaces.

In addition to creating a cozy atmosphere in addition to providing a cozy atmosphere, these units can be used as supplemental heaters in smaller rooms of your home. They're great for living rooms and dining areas, and could be placed in the bedroom to add additional warmth. Unlike traditional fireplaces, electric fireplaces don't create ash or smoke that's why they're less messy and safer to use.

There are several different types of freestanding electric fireplaces on the market. These range from compact models which look more like stylish room heaters to larger ones designed to be the center point of a space. Some feature a classic coal-effect or log fuel bed and others come with more modern options such as a textured pebble or a color-changing flame effect. A majority of these units have a remote control to allow you to adjust the settings, and turn on and off the heat and flame effects.

Efficiency

Electric fireplaces are a simple, safe and cost-effective way to enjoy fire without the mess or expense associated with wood burning. They are also simple to install and do not require a chimney, gas lines or ventilation. They are also mobile and can be moved from one room to another as your requirements change.

They use either a fan-forced heater or an infrared heating element that heats the room. Both are efficient in energy efficiency, converting 100 percent of the electricity used into heat. The most important thing is to select the model that has the correct power for the size of your room. The wattage will be displayed as an kW number and more info you ought to find it on the unit's own, in its specifications or product description or by contacting the manufacturer.

Divide the electricity input by the heat output to calculate the energy efficiency of your electric fireplace. The result will be a percentage, and you can evaluate it with similar models to find the most efficient one for your space.

Although you won't be allowed to make use of an electric fireplace as your primary heat source, it will help keep your home warm and comfortable, in addition to your central heating system. It can also add warmth to small, well-insulated spaces that are difficult to heat using other methods.

Electric fireplaces do not emit harmful gases like carbon monoxide or smoke. You don't have to worry about fire hazards or safety concerns. They also won't increase the cost of homeowner's insurance like a wood-burning fireplace would.

Safety

In contrast to gas or wood fireplaces, electric fires don't emit any harmful gases. They simply heat the air inside your home. They are safer to use around pets and children, and don't build up soot or a creosote layer. They also don't require an endless supply of oxygen to continue burning, which can make them more efficient than other types of fireplaces.

Electric fireplaces can be installed inside rooms that are impossible to heat using a traditional fireplace. This is especially true for homes with built-in shelves, windows or other obstacles. If you're looking for an alternative, there are models that can be integrated into TV stands and entertainment centers. There are also wall-mounted units that can be mounted on flat surfaces.

The majority of models of an electric fireplace freestanding feature an remote control that allows you to easily turn the unit on or off. They are also able to operate on an extremely low wattage which helps them conserve energy in your home. This is good for the environment and your electric bills.

The most popular electric fireplaces that are freestanding have a faux-log design that makes them appear more real. Some models have a flame LED light can be adjusted to alter the color. You can also pick from various fire settings, ranging from a more traditional blaze to a more modern flicker.

An electric fireplace can be connected to any outlet in your home, but it is recommended to install it on a dedicated circuit. This will keep the appliance from overheating and causing an electrical fire. If you have pets or children, it is important to keep them away from the fireplace, as they may try to climb over it.
